beautypg.com

Dma scripts pointer (dsp), Scripts pointer (dsp), Dma command (dcmd) – Avago Technologies LSI53C895A User Manual

Page 173: Dma scripts, Pointer (dsp), Next address (dnad), Dma next address (dnad), Register: 0x27, Registers: 0x2c–0x2f

background image

SCSI Registers

4-65

Register: 0x27

DMA Command (DCMD)
Read/Write

DCMD

DMA Command

[7:0]

This 8-bit register determines the instruction for the
LSI53C895A to execute. This register has a different
format for each instruction. For a complete description
see

Chapter 5, “SCSI SCRIPTS Instruction Set.”

Registers: 0x28–0x2B

DMA Next Address (DNAD)
Read/Write

DNAD

DMA Next Address

[31:0]

This 32-bit register contains the general purpose address
pointer. At the start of some SCRIPTS operations, its
value is copied from the

DMA SCRIPTS Pointer Save

(DSPS)

register. Its value may not be valid except in

certain abort conditions. The default value of this register
is zero.

Registers: 0x2C–0x2F

DMA SCRIPTS Pointer (DSP)
Read/Write

DSP

DMA SCRIPTS Pointer

[31:0]

To execute SCSI SCRIPTS, the address of the first
SCRIPTS instruction must be written to this register. In
normal SCRIPTS operation, once the starting address of

7

0

DCMD

0

1

x

x

x

x

x

x

31

0

DNAD

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

31

0

DSP

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0

0